pics: MorMor @ Baby's All Right
Toronto’s MorMor has been on the rise thanks to the unique, soulful, driving indie rock of his great 2018 EP Heaven’s Only Wistful and the two singles that followed, “Pass The Hours” and “Outside.” We’re still waiting on the news of his debut album, but in the meantime he’s on tour now and just played a packed, sold-out Brooklyn show at Baby’s All Right on Friday (4/19).
He played a good chunk of the songs he has released so far, and he brought his own lights which had him often shadowed and dimly lit, giving the songs an extra mysterious quality. He was also joined by a solid band, who did a great job of fleshing out the songs. He didn’t say much on stage except to introduce the band and say thanks, letting the music speak for it self. duendita opened, and pictures are in the gallery above.
